By the mid-1970s, Porsche had already spent a decade proving the 911 could win, but the bigger question was how far that platform could be pushed before something gave way. Group 4 racing gave Porsche its first real answer in 1976 with the 934, a car that kept the recognizable shape of a road-going 911 Turbo while quietly rewriting everything underneath it.

The fenders widened to swallow racing rubber, a fixed rear wing appeared where a trunk lid used to sit, and the turbocharged flat six was tuned past 480 horsepower. From across a parking lot, it still looked like something a customer could drive home. Up close, at speed, it behaved like nothing of the sort.

Group 5 rules, running in that same era, offered something rarer: freedom. The regulations demanded a production silhouette and left almost everything else open to interpretation. Porsche read that loophole the way only Porsche could, and in 1976 the 935 was the result, marking 2026 as its 50th anniversary. The outline of a 911 was still there if you squinted, but underneath, the standard steel structure was reinforced with an aluminum roll cage and fabricated subframes, wrapped in flared bodywork stretched over tires wider than anything the road car ever saw. The pop-up headlights disappeared in favor of a flat nose shaped in the wind tunnel rather than a design studio. Output climbed past 600 horsepower in race trim and kept climbing from there. Porsche didn’t just enter Group 5 with the 935. It rewrote what the category meant.

The factory team kept refining the formula for years, from the sharpened aerodynamics of the 935/77 to the long, low 935/78 that chased top speed down the Mulsanne Straight under the nickname Moby Dick. Championships followed, as they tend to when Porsche commits to something fully. But the version of this story that people still tell decades later didn’t come out of the factory at all. It came from a small German outfit that took Porsche’s own recipe and made it better.

Kremer Racing built their own take on the 935, called the K3, reworking the chassis into a proper tube frame and chasing something a factory team rarely optimizes for: the ability to still be running at the end. That distinction mattered more than anyone could have predicted heading into Le Mans in 1979. The race that year was supposed to belong to the purpose-built prototypes, the cars engineered from a blank sheet with no road-going obligations at all. Instead, a Kremer 935 K3 crossed the finish line first overall, driven by Klaus Ludwig alongside two American brothers, Don and Bill Whittington. It remains the first rear-engine car ever to win Le Mans outright, and a production-derived GT car had just beaten a field of purpose-built prototypes on their own turf.

That same race had its own brush with Hollywood. Right behind the Whittingtons’ winning 935 came another one, driven in part by Paul Newman, who finished second overall in his first and only Le Mans start. A movie star nearly won the biggest race in the world in the same car that made history a few positions ahead of him.

The Whittingtons weren’t your typical gentleman racers padding out a grid. They showed up with the resources to buy the best equipment available and, just as importantly, the talent to actually drive it to a win rather than simply finish the race. Bill and Don would go on to own Road Atlanta itself, a track that had already built a reputation hosting some of the country’s toughest endurance racing. Their Le Mans victory wasn’t bought. It held up against everything else on that grid, prototypes included.
